With the increasing the number of the students in the universities and senior high schools, the traditional vocational education of our country goes down dramatically, that results in a large number of students with low math learning ability enter into vocational schools. As teachers in these kinds of school, how to face them? What is the reason? How to improve them? All these are the realistic mission for teachers. we should change our teaching concept, acquire new talent outlook and quality outlook so that we can foster students into useful persons to the society.The main methods that this passage adopts in the research process are: the cultural heritage data, investigation which includes the questionnaire, inquisition the interviewers, case study and teaching experiment etc. by investigating 358 students with poor ability in math, I have studied the existing present state of such students with pertinent theories and teaching experience. From that, I have found out the main reasons of how such students coming into being. They lie in two aspects of students′learning process: the cognition obstacle and emotion obstacle, the cognition obstacle includes intelligence, knowledge and learning methods. The emotion obstacle includes non-intelligence.Investigating the causes of the students with poor ability in math learning, base on"the three—level theory"by Japanese educationist北尾伦彦and"the concentric circle theory"by Russian educationist巴班斯基.According to the causation of the students with low math learning ability, combining the relevant theories, they are divided into two sorts: some students with cognition obstacle and others with emotion obstacle.
